General Aviation Terminal - Berlin

This concept proposal reimagines a 516 m² VIP terminal in Berlin, transforming an outdated facility into a contemporary and welcoming environment for private aviation passengers and crew.

The design combines the elegance of luxury hospitality with the functional requirements of a busy aviation terminal. The layout was developed to improve passenger flow while creating distinct areas for arrivals, departures, relaxation and operational support. Spaces include a reception lounge, passenger waiting areas, crew lounge, rest facilities and a dedicated drivers’ waiting area.

Inspired by premium hotels and private aviation experiences, the concept focuses on soft architectural forms, refined materials and a calm, sophisticated atmosphere. The result is a terminal that balances operational efficiency with comfort, privacy and a high-end customer experience.
